Re: Known Issues w/ Rollerballs

Usually the problem with trackballs is that they get dirty. Pocket lint, dust, oil/grease from hands, etc are likely causes. Instead of purchasing a new device at full retail you could have purchase a replacement trackball. There are lots of places on the web selling the part for $9-$15. Simple replacement, just pop the silver ring off and the track ball assembly falls out. Swap in the new one and replace the ring.
